The Hori Hori carbon steel knife is a versatile Japanese gardening tool, prized for its multi-purpose design ideal for digging, weeding, transplanting, and pruning in tough soils.

Key Features

Forged from high-carbon steel (often SK-5 or similar), it offers exceptional sharpness and strength with a concave, pointed blade around 6-7 inches long, featuring one straight edge and one serrated side for roots and branches.
Overall length typically 11-12 inches with a sturdy wooden handle (beech or walnut) and full tang for durability; includes depth markings for precise planting and a sheath for safety.
Weight around 0.7 lbs, making it robust yet balanced for extended garden use.

Maintenance Tips

Wipe clean and apply oil after use to prevent rust on the carbon steel blade; sharpen both edges regularly with a stone.
Store in its vinyl or canvas sheath to protect the edge and ensure longevity.
